For most of my life, I was chasing the “win” I thought I was supposed to want.


Go to college. Get the degree. Land the big job. Buy the house. Build the résumé. On paper, I did all those things – and did them well. I spent over two decades in corporate strategy and consulting, climbing ladders and realizing success. But despite every checkbox I ticked, something always felt off. I was achieving more, but feeling less.


The truth? I was professionally successful but spiritually unanchored. And that tension haunted me for years. I could lead a boardroom, but I would quietly panic at night, realizing I didn’t believe the faith stories I’d been taught. I wanted to believe in something – but I needed it to be real. Practical. Something that made sense to my brain and my heart.


That question sat dormant until the birth of my daughter – then it exploded into urgency. I needed a belief system that felt authentic to me. One I’d be proud to turn to in motherhood, to model in my daily life, and to pass down to her with confidence. One rooted in love, not fear.


In 2023, burnt out and questioning everything, I finally stepped away from the corporate world. I wasn’t just looking for another job – I was searching for meaning.
